Comparative developmental anatomy of ovary and fruit in Brazilian Velloziaceae

Abstract

Abstract Morpho-anatomical studies of fruits are scarce in monocotyledons and particularly for the Brazilian species of Velloziaceae, a small family of monocots characteristic of the campo rupestre vegetation of Brazil. The main fruit types found in Velloziaceae are poricidal and loculicidal capsules, but capsule morphology is variable, which has led to discrepancies regarding fruit descriptions and terminology. In this study, we aimed to analyse fruit development in Brazilian Velloziaceae to obtain a better understanding of capsule dehiscence and to elucidate and describe in detail the fruit types occurring in the family. Based on our results, we discuss the terminology used to describe capsules of some species, e.g. capsules of Vellozia minima and V. epidendroides, previously classified as poricidal, should be called apical loculicidal, as they form three slits on the uppermost part of each carpel that are prevented from extending downwards by the precocious lignification of the pericarp. Capsules of Barbacenia purpurea, B. riparia and B. plantaginea have been classified using various terms, but they fit the definition of fissuricidal capsule and should be classified as such. We also propose an improved analysis for the character ‘fruit type’, previously used in phylogenetic reconstructions of Velloziaceae. We changed some states following the fruit reclassification proposed here and added a new state, ‘capsule opening through lateral irregular aperture’, to the character. Additionally, eight new phylogenetic characters derived from ovary and fruit characteristics are suggested.
